Output 0857709638417a60ecd994ad2d88868452bfef42863f235c979c7424f365ca84:1

value
609916396588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0455112c36804ca070e3628fce331bf9159c8b80 OP_EQUALVERIFY OP_CHECKSIG
address
D5Y19bBYzqPKqc84BZyjxp2W3wgF32Hx4o
transaction
0857709638417a60ecd994ad2d88868452bfef42863f235c979c7424f365ca84